L’abbaye de Fontfroide à 10mn de Narbonne est un bijou de l’Occitanie et de la France. Fondée en 1093 par les Bénédictins, elle est intégrée plus tard dans l’ordre cistercien. Fontfroide fut rachetée en 1908 par Gustave Fayet (1865-1925) et sa femme Madeleine. Gustave Fayet a été un personnage totalement hors du commun : entrepreneur, artiste, peintre, décorateur, mécène, il fut un très grand coll...

Reviews Summary

Visitors consistently praise Abbaye de Fontfroide for its stunning historical architecture, particularly the vaulted cloisters and chapel, and its beautiful, expansive gardens with walking trails. The on-site restaurant is also a highlight, though booking ahead is advised. Some minor drawbacks include occasional shortages of English information and the potential for the restaurant to be fully booked.

🚇 🗺️ Getting There

Abbaye de Fontfroide is conveniently located just 10 minutes from Narbonne. Driving is the most common method, with ample parking available, including a specific area for motorhomes. Reddit

Information on direct public transport is limited, but it's a short drive from Narbonne, making it easily accessible by car or taxi. Reddit

There is plenty of parking available, with a dedicated section for motorhomes and campers. Reddit

The abbey is situated in a beautiful region, and driving through the surrounding countryside offers lovely views. Pay attention when driving as there are beautiful monuments in the way and around. Reddit
